Desarrollo de Apps Móviles: ¿Nativo o Híbrido? Guía Estratégica para el Éxito de tu Negocio
En el panorama empresarial actual, tener una presencia móvil no es solo una ventaja competitiva, sino una necesidad fundamental. Sin embargo, antes de escribir la primera línea de código, surge una pregunta que definirá el futuro financiero y técnico de tu proyecto: ¿Debemos desarrollar una app nativa o una híbrida?
Esta decisión no debe tomarse a la ligera, ya que influye directamente en el costo de desarrollo, la velocidad de lanzamiento y la experiencia del usuario final. Como expertos en tecnología y negocios, en este artículo desglosaremos ambas opciones para ayudarte a tomar la decisión más rentable para tu empresa.
¿Qué es el Desarrollo de Apps Nativas?
El desarrollo nativo consiste en crear una aplicación específica para un sistema operativo particular, utilizando los lenguajes y herramientas proporcionados por los fabricantes. Para iOS, esto significa usar Swift o Objective-C, mientras que para Android se utiliza Kotlin o Java.
Al trabajar directamente con las APIs del sistema, las aplicaciones nativas tienen un acceso total al hardware del dispositivo. Esto incluye la cámara, el GPS, los sensores de movimiento y el sistema de archivos de manera optimizada y sin intermediarios.
Ventajas de las Apps Nativas para tu Negocio
- Rendimiento Superior: Son las aplicaciones más rápidas y fluidas del mercado. Esto se traduce en una mejor retención de usuarios, ya que nadie tolera una app que se congela o tarda en cargar.
- Experiencia de Usuario (UX) Impecable: Al seguir las guías de diseño de Apple o Google, la interfaz se siente natural para el usuario. Una navegación intuitiva reduce la fricción y aumenta las tasas de conversión.
- Seguridad Avanzada: Al no depender de marcos de trabajo de terceros, las apps nativas permiten implementar medidas de seguridad más robustas. Esto es vital para sectores como el Fintech o la salud.
- Acceso a Funciones de Última Generación: Tienes acceso inmediato a las nuevas características que Apple o Google lanzan cada año, permitiendo que tu negocio sea pionero en innovación.
¿Qué es el Desarrollo de Apps Híbridas y Multiplataforma?
Las aplicaciones híbridas o multiplataforma permiten utilizar un único código base para funcionar tanto en iOS como en Android. Tecnologías modernas como Flutter (de Google) o React Native (de Meta) han revolucionado este sector, borrando casi por completo la línea entre lo híbrido y lo nativo.
En lugar de construir dos aplicaciones por separado, tu equipo de desarrollo construye una sola que se adapta a ambos mundos. Esto ofrece una eficiencia logística y económica sin precedentes para empresas en crecimiento.
Ventajas de las Apps Híbridas para tu Estrategia Empresarial
- Reducción de Costos Significativa: Desarrollar un solo código base puede ahorrar entre un 30% y un 50% del presupuesto inicial. Menos horas de desarrollo significan una inversión inicial más baja.
- Time-to-Market Acelerado: En los negocios, la velocidad es clave. Con el desarrollo híbrido, puedes lanzar tu producto en ambas tiendas simultáneamente en la mitad del tiempo.
- Mantenimiento Simplificado: Cuando necesitas actualizar una función o corregir un error, solo lo haces una vez. Esto reduce los costos operativos a largo plazo y permite que tu equipo sea más ágil y eficiente.
- Consistencia de Marca: Al usar el mismo código, garantizas que la experiencia de marca sea idéntica en todos los dispositivos. Esto fortalece la identidad visual de tu empresa.
Comparativa Directa: Impacto en el Retorno de Inversión (ROI)
Para decidir qué camino tomar, es necesario analizar cómo cada opción afecta los objetivos de negocio. No siempre la opción más barata es la más rentable, ni la más sofisticada es la más necesaria.
1. Presupuesto y Recursos
Si eres una startup con un presupuesto limitado que busca validar una idea, el desarrollo híbrido es tu mejor aliado. Te permite llegar a todo el mercado (iOS y Android) con una inversión controlada. Por el contrario, si el presupuesto no es el problema y buscas la perfección absoluta, el desarrollo nativo es la inversión premium.
2. Complejidad del Producto
¿Tu app requiere procesar videos en alta definición, realidad aumentada o cálculos matemáticos complejos? Entonces el desarrollo nativo es obligatorio. Si tu app es principalmente de contenido, comercio electrónico o gestión de datos, las soluciones híbridas son más que suficientes y altamente eficientes.
3. Escalabilidad y Futuro
Las aplicaciones híbridas modernas escalan excepcionalmente bien. Sin embargo, para empresas que planean tener millones de usuarios activos simultáneos con funciones muy específicas del sistema, el control que ofrece lo nativo puede evitar cuellos de botella tecnológicos en el futuro.
¿Cómo Elegir la Mejor Opción para tu Empresa?
Para facilitar tu toma de decisiones, considera las siguientes preguntas estratégicas:
- ¿Qué tan rápido necesitas lanzar? Si la respuesta es "ayer", elige Híbrido/Multiplataforma.
- ¿La experiencia de usuario es tu mayor diferenciador? Si buscas ganar premios de diseño o una fluidez extrema, elige Nativo.
- ¿Cuál es tu presupuesto de mantenimiento? Si quieres optimizar costos recurrentes, el Híbrido es el ganador indiscutible.
- ¿Necesitas hardware específico? Si dependes fuertemente de sensores complejos o Bluetooth de baja energía, el Nativo te dará menos problemas de integración.
El Rol de la Tecnología en el Crecimiento del Negocio
Independientemente de la tecnología elegida, el objetivo final de una app móvil debe ser generar valor. Una aplicación bien construida ahorra dinero al automatizar procesos, aumenta las ventas al estar en el bolsillo del cliente y mejora la eficiencia operativa.
El error más común de los negocios es elegir la tecnología basándose solo en el precio. Un ahorro inicial en una app híbrida mal ejecutada puede costar caro en soporte técnico. Por otro lado, gastar una fortuna en desarrollo nativo para una app sencilla puede drenar capital que se necesitaba para marketing.
Por ello, la clave del éxito no está solo en el código, sino en la estrategia de consultoría previa. Entender el modelo de negocio, el comportamiento del usuario y los objetivos a largo plazo es lo que realmente determina el éxito tecnológico de un proyecto.
Conclusión: Transforma tu Visión en Realidad
La elección entre el desarrollo nativo e híbrido marcará el rumbo de tu presencia digital. Ambas rutas tienen el potencial de transformar tu negocio, ahorrar costos y abrir nuevos canales de ingresos, siempre y cuando se implementen con la maestría técnica adecuada.
En DevHood, no solo escribimos código; diseñamos soluciones tecnológicas alineadas con tus objetivos de negocio. Contamos con la experiencia necesaria para asesorarte y ejecutar el desarrollo de tu aplicación utilizando las tecnologías más vanguardistas del mercado, ya sea mediante un enfoque nativo de alto rendimiento o una solución híbrida altamente eficiente.
¿Estás listo para llevar tu negocio al siguiente nivel con una aplicación móvil de clase mundial?
Contacta con el equipo de DevHood hoy mismo y permítenos ayudarte a elegir y construir la solución perfecta para tu empresa. Nuestra consultoría experta convertirá tu idea en una herramienta poderosa para el crecimiento y la eficiencia.